Role Overview This role sits within the Trade Surveillance Technology function, supporting the design, enhancement, and delivery of surveillance platforms that underpin TP ICAP’s market conduct and regulatory obligations.

The Business Analyst will act as a critical interface between Compliance, Front Office, and Technology, translating regulatory requirements and surveillance use cases into scalable technology solutions. The position offers exposure to complex trade and communication surveillance frameworks across multiple asset classes, with scope to contribute to strategic platform evolution, data quality improvements, and control uplift initiatives.

Key Responsibilities Business Analysis & Delivery Elicit, analyse, and document business requirements for surveillance systems, including trade and e-communications monitoring tools

Produce high-quality functional specifications, user stories, and acceptance criteria aligned to Agile delivery practices

Map current (“as-is”) and future (“to-be”) surveillance workflows, identifying opportunities for process optimisation and automation

Support the end-to-end delivery lifecycle, including design, build, testing, and implementation

Surveillance & Regulatory Alignment Work closely with Compliance and Surveillance teams to understand regulatory obligations (e.g. market abuse, trade reporting, conduct risk) and translate these into system requirements

Support the development and enhancement of alerting frameworks, including parameter tuning, calibration, and governance processes

Contribute to initiatives focused on improving surveillance effectiveness, data lineage, and auditability

Data & Technology Engagement Analyse complex trade and order data flows across front-to-back systems to ensure accuracy, completeness, and traceability

Partner with Technology teams (Engineering, Data, QA) to ensure solutions are scalable, resilient, and aligned to architectural standards

Support integration of surveillance platforms with internal systems and external vendor solutions

Stakeholder Management Act as a trusted advisor to business stakeholders, bridging the gap between technical teams and non-technical users

Facilitate workshops, requirements gathering sessions, and solution walkthroughs

Provide clear and concise communication to stakeholders at all levels, including updates on delivery progress and key risks

Testing & Governance Define and execute test scenarios, including SIT and UAT support, ensuring solutions meet business and regulatory requirements

Ensure appropriate documentation, controls, and governance artefacts are maintained in line with audit and compliance expectations
